Homewood Community Sports: Empowering Kids to Succeed Beyond the Field – KD Sunday Spotlight

Homewood County Sports is a nonprofit organization dedicated to helping children and teenagers succeed not only on the field but also in life. Our team of volunteers is driven by the goal of making kids happy and steering them away from violence by encouraging their involvement in sports.

One of our shining examples is Mubarik Ismaeli, also known as “Coach Mu.” Having grown up in Pittsburgh’s Homewood neighborhood, Coach Mu understands the value of hard work from a young age. He now leads our organization as the president and executive director, fulfilling his desire to give back to the community that supported him.

Established in the 1950s, Homewood Community Sports offers various sports options, including football, cheerleading, rugby, wrestling, and track and field. Our coaches, who are all volunteers, not only teach children how to excel in their chosen sports but also instill vital life skills such as teamwork, conflict resolution, and being part of something bigger than themselves.

We currently have around 260 kids aged 5 to 14 participating in our football and cheerleading programs. Excitingly, our Homewood Bulldawgs will soon be playing on a brand-new field, a project that we have eagerly awaited for years. This renovation will also enable us to expand our offerings to include sports like soccer and lacrosse.

While we strive to create a safe and positive environment for our kids, we acknowledge the tragedy that recently struck our community. The loss of 12-year-old Denzel Nowlin Junior to gun violence deeply affected us all, and we dedicate our season to his memory. It drives us to do even more for the children, ensuring they never have to endure such trauma and promoting a disciplined and positive upbringing.

Our coaches play a multitude of roles, acting as mentors, babysitters, nurses, and teachers to the kids. We even extend our support to academic struggles by assisting in schools. By being involved in our program, children thrive at home, improve academically, and experience stronger family and community bonds.
